Ticket: Crashfall ingest failing on staging

New folks, please read carefully. The Pebblekit mobile app's crash reports aren't reaching the symbolication queue because staging's env file was copied without its upload credential. Symptoms: 401s in the collector logs every five minutes. To fix, add the missing line to the env file, exactly as follows.

secret setting of fafop-tagep: VAULT_KEY29=6a815d21e2d77cc25ef1802d73ee6

Mira — the batch of calibration weights from the Dorrance lab is boxed and labelled, twelve pieces total, certificates in the side pouch. Store them in the climate cabinet until Thursday's audit; don't stack anything on the case. The Quillon courier picks them up Friday morning at the loading dock. He has been told to release them only against the phrase noted below.

handover note for yagef-bagep: the drudor pelius courier leaves the kasdor zorvan norir ledger at gate 8016 under passcode 755406

- [ ] Before the Quillhaven signing ceremony proceeds, run the leaked-file-descriptor hunt on the offline signer. As a new contractor, please be thorough: enumerate every open descriptor on the sealed host, confirm nothing points at the ceremony scratch volume, and log each finding in the Larkspur register. If any descriptor traces back to the retired Fenwick exporter, halt and page the ceremony lead. Once the host shows a clean descriptor table, unlock the escrow envelope using the phrase below.

unlock words, yajof-tagef: aldiel-kasath-briax-fraeth-pelius-olieth-pelix-wenius-wenael-norael